Тормозит жесткий диск — Сайт notebookremont!

При проблемах с производительностью жёсткого диска, нужно во первых очистить винчестер от мусора, затем провести дефрагментацию и в самом конце проверить жёсткий диск на ошибки , так же ваш «винт» может тормозить из-за сбойных секторов (бэд-блоков), так же читайте наши статьи: Что такое сбойные сектора и как их убрать с помощью программы HDDScan. 

Принесли компьютер и жалуются на низкое быстродействие, пытались переустановить операционную систему, не помогает, комплектующие не прошлого века, работать должен на твёрдую четвёрку, только вот одно но…

На первое, что бы я обратил внимание, это правильное подсоединение перемычек на жёстких дисках, но про это у нас есть отдельная статья Перемычки на жестком диске, можете ознакомиться, у нас же оказалась проблема в другом. Иногда два устройства IDE подключаются не совсем правильно, например к одному разъёму IDE на материнской плате с помощью шлейфа подключают жёсткий диск как устройство Мастер и CD/DVD как устройство (Slave).  Многие могут сказать что правильно, ведь винчестер главнее, да это так, но дисковод почти всегда работает медленнее чем жёсткий диск, а подключены они одним шлейфом. Значит контроллер IDE переключает оба устройства в более медленный режим дисковода, в нашем случае было именно так. Если вы имеете дело со старенькой конфигурацией, всегда лучше подключать жёсткий диск отдельно от дисковода, на отдельный шлейф. Тоже самое применимо и к двум жёстким дискам подключенным к одному шлейфу, они оба должны поддерживать самый быстрый режим передачи данных. Если один винчестер более медленный и работает в режиме Ultra ATA/100, то другой более быстрый, предназначенный для работы в режиме Ultra ATA/133, будет работать на скорости медленного Ultra ATA/100.

Запускаю компьютер, идём в диспетчер устройств, далее IDE ATA/ATAPI контроллеры, выбираем пункт Первичный канал IDE, щёлкаем по каждому каналу два раза левой кнопкой мыши и заходим во вкладку Дополнительные параметры. Вижу, дисковод вместе с жёстким диском работают в режиме РIО, не больше не меньше, вот так бывает, конечно будет тормозить жёсткий диск.

Пришлось докупать дополнительно шлейф IDE и подключать к материнской плате каждое устройство отдельно. Пришлось так же менять дисковод, не совсем старый, но видимо не исправный, он работал только в режиме РIО, даже на другом компьютере, ничего мы с ним так и не сделали.

PIO (Programmable Input/Output) – довольно устаревший режим работы устройств, при работе он задействует центральный процессор, несомненно это снижает производительность.

DMA (Direct Memory Access) –режим при котором жёсткий диск или дисковод напрямую обращается к оперативной памяти, что конечно в разы увеличивает производительность работы.

  1. Конечно режим DMA использовать предпочтительнее, но иногда при частых ошибках чтения с жёсткого диска, Windows XP переключает режим DMA в PIO. И встаёт вопрос, как включить режим DMA? В первую очередь попробуем выставить в пункте «Режим передачи» режим «DMA, если доступно» далее «ОК» и перезагружаемся. Компьютер загрузился, идём в Диспетчер устройств и видим Режим передачи, везде стоит DMA, значит у нас всё получилось, если нет, пробуем ещё способ.
  2. Нужно переустановить драйвера на материнскую плату, это тоже иногда помогает.
  3. Вы должны использовать 80-ти жильный шлейф для подключения данного устройства, так же попробуйте поменять шлейф IDE или подключите жёсткий диск к другому разъёму на материнской плате, предварительно осмотрев его на предмет погнутых контактов. 
  4. Для возвращения режима DMA можно использовать реестр, нужно отключить систему контроля ошибок и вручную выставить режим DMA, но этот метод лучше использовать в последнюю очередь, можете почитать у нас в статье PIO и DMA, а сейчас попробуем сначала пункт№5.
  5. Удаляем Первичный и Вторичный каналы IDE, наводим на них мышь, щёлкаем правой кнопкой мыши и выбираем удалить, вновь перезагружаемся, операционная система должна найти контроллеры и перевести в Режим передачи DMA.

Удаление первичного канала  IDE